What is an administrative assistant?

An administrative assistant performs clerical tasks that are vital to an efficiently run office. As an administrative assistant, your job duties affect the daily operations of the office as a whole. You provide administrative support for other employees, such as filing paperwork, handling email communications, and preparing documents and presentations. You’re responsible for data entry, including looking up records when necessary and maintaining a well-organized records system. You also answer telephone calls and direct callers to the right person. Although much of your administrative assistant job requires sitting at a desk, you need excellent interpersonal and communication skills.

What does an assistant administrator do?

An Assistant Administrator supports the daily operations of an organization by handling administrative tasks such as scheduling meetings, managing correspondence, maintaining records, and assisting with budgeting or project coordination. They often serve as a liaison between staff, management, and external stakeholders to ensure smooth workflow and communication. Their role can vary depending on the industry but generally focuses on keeping administrative processes efficient and organized.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Administrator,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a background in business administration or a related field. Familiarity with office management software such as Microsoft Office Suite and scheduling systems is typically required. Excellent communication, multitasking, and problem-solving abilities help you excel in supporting teams and managing daily operations. These skills are essential for ensuring efficient workflow, smooth administrative processes, and effective support of organizational goals.

What are some common challenges faced by assistant administrators, and how can they effectively manage competing priorities?

Assistant Administrators often juggle multiple tasks such as scheduling, correspondence, and supporting various departments, which can lead to competing demands on their time. Effective time management and strong organizational skills are crucial for prioritizing urgent tasks while maintaining attention to detail. Open communication with supervisors and colleagues also helps clarify expectations and ensure that critical responsibilities are addressed promptly. Utilizing digital tools for task tracking and calendar management can further streamline workflow and reduce stress.

What is the difference between Assistant Administrator vs Office Manager?

AspectAssistant AdministratorOffice Manager
CredentialsTypically requires a high school diploma or associate degree; some roles prefer a bachelor's degreeUsually requires a high school diploma; some positions prefer a bachelor's degree or relevant experience
Work EnvironmentAdministrative offices, healthcare facilities, educational institutionsCorporate offices, small to medium businesses, healthcare settings
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across various industries including healthcare, education, and governmentCommonly found in business, healthcare, and nonprofit organizations
Primary ResponsibilitiesSupporting administrative tasks, assisting with operations, coordinating schedulesOverseeing office operations, managing staff, ensuring efficiency

While both roles support office functions, an Assistant Administrator typically focuses on assisting with administrative tasks and supporting management, whereas an Office Manager has broader responsibilities including supervising staff and managing daily operations.

Skills and attributes for success:
The Contractor shall provide the following services to include but not limited to: 
-         The Contractor shall provide database administration support to include, but not limited to the following activities: 
-         Contractor shall assist in managing Microsoft SQL Server 2019 and 2022 to include setting up security, creating tables, indexes, stored procedures, designing SQL reports, and creating maintenance jobs etc. Must apply best practices for optimizing databases; 
-         Contractor shall assist in creating and maintaining databases in a Clustered Server environment. Must apply expert knowledge of the design, development and maintenance of various data models and their components; 
-         Contractor shall apply working knowledge of data lakes, data warehouse and data mart architectures, metadata and data modeling, data flow, entity relationship diagram, schema architectures and query languages to integrate a seamless solution within legacy infrastructure; 
-         Contractor shall mirror database servers, log shipping, latest techniques for Database redundancy and high Availability, and full backup and recovery capabilities of the Microsoft SQL Server 2019 and 2022 platform; 
-         Contractor shall facilitate the migration of system into cloud infrastructure. 
-         Contractor shall upgrade SQL Servers from lower versions to the latest version (version 2019 and up), and create reports using Microsoft SQL Server Reporting Services (SSRS); 
-         Contractor shall setup a reporting server and be responsible for all DBA functions and report development utilizing Software Systems development Architecture and Design.
